I want the premium content to appear just like all other posts in the archive lists with title, thumb, date. Now the view is displaying the login form instead. I don't want View to display the login form
Given that you've restricted the Post Type to only users who are premium and logged in then the archive will require that you have a premium account to view ass well.
Unfortunately this is how it works and there isn't a workaround unless you're not restricting the post type but rather the individual post or even the contents of the posts using a content template.
This way users can still navigate to the post but only the users who have the permissions can view the actual content of the post.